Ruptured mycotic iliac artery aneurysm presenting as infected psoas haematoma and mimicking psoas abscess
Pseudoaneurysm of the iliac arteries are rarely reported in the literature. Failure to identify the pathology may delay the necessary treatment, and potentially lead to high mortality.
